The documentary Fed Up highlights the significant influence of the food industry on government and the public through lobbying and advertising. With billions of dollars at stake, the industry influences policies and consumer decisions by investing heavily in marketing campaigns. The movie explains with simple graphics that sugar consumption forces your body to make and store fat. The movie documents the amazing increase in sugar consumption since the 1970s, both directly as sugar-based food and drink, and indirectly as added sugars in processed foods. The 2014 film Fed Up is an advocacy documentary. Its message: There is a worldwide epidemic of obesity. It is endangering our children. Increased sugar consumption is responsible.
